Dhanbad, July 19: Week-long workshop on ‘Electric Vehicles and its Key Components’ began here at BIT Sindri on Friday.

The BIT Sindri Electrical Engineering Department has organized this week-long workshop (July 19 to 24) as part of the Platinum Jubilee Celebration of the institution.

The premier technical institute which will complete 75 years in November, will host a total of 75 national as well as international programmes which already started from November 2023.

Latest advancements in EV technology

Convenors of the workshop, Dr Rahul Kumar and Dr Murli Manohar, of the electrical engineering department said the main objective of the event is to provide participants with an in-depth understanding of the latest advancements in electric vehicle (EV) technology.

“The workshop covers an overview of EV key components, design considerations, and prospects,” they said.

Dr Md. Abul Kalam, head of the electrical engineering department, welcomed the speakers and provided a comprehensive explanation of the key issues and opportunities associated with electric vehicles.

The coordinators said that on the first day of the workshop experts and industry leaders discussed and shared their insights, offering valuable knowledge and perspectives.
